The journey by train from Jaipur to Udaipur is scheduled to take between 7 hours 15 minutes and 9 hours 40 minutes depending upon which train service you take. Via the shortest route the distance travelled is 429 km.

City Palace in Udaipur
The City Palace is Udaipur’s main tourist attraction. The City Palace is a sprawling complex of palaces and other buildings built over several centuries from 1553 onward. The City Palace is one of the largest royal residences in Rajasthan, a region of Indian famed for its palaces. The buildings are constructed out entirely from marble and granite and reflect a wide range of architectural style including Mughal, European, Chinese as well as native Rajasthani architecture. In these respects Udaipur’s City Palace is unique.

City Palace is still owned by the same family which built it, although they lost considerable power when they signed a treaty aligning themselves to the British in 1818 and then subsequently their royal titles when Udaipur joined a newly independent India in 1948. Large palaces like the one in Udaipur are very expensive to operate and maintain and the previously ruling family have managed to fund this massive expensive by opening the palace as a tourist attraction, letting out shop spaces, and creating a luxury hotel in the Fateprakash Palace. There is an entrance of 500 INR for foreign visitors, and 250 INR for Indian nationals, to the City Palace, which is open every day from 09:30 to 17:30.
